This has the potential to devastate a huge and growing scientific research industry in Kansas City. We need to stay on top of this issue!Absent a compromise — which appears unlikely — (Matt) Bartle's proposal to ban the procedure known as therapeutic cloning is dead for this session.
Bartle's idea of a compromise is to legislate a three-year moratorium on research until more information is available. That is simply a ban by another name and would put Missouri far behind other states, some of which are subsidizing stem-cell research.
An official from the Stowers Institute for Medical Research in Kansas City said the institute will continue to delay plans for a second facility until the threat to stem-cell research is definitely past.That time should be now. A statewide poll taken this year showed Missourians support embryonic stem-cell research two to one. Bartle has had his day on the Senate floor, and was unconvincing. Legislative leaders and Gov. Matt Blunt should put the issue to rest.
